Denim provides a rich and fascinating heritage that dates again into the 18th century. The fabric originated in Nimes, France, exactly where it had been often called "serge de Nimes," which inevitably advanced into your phrase "denim." It had been in the beginning used for workwear as a result of its sturdiness and power, making it the fabric of choice for laborers and miners. In the late 19th century, Levi Strauss, a German immigrant, and Jacob Davis, a tailor, patented the first denim denims with copper rivets, revolutionizing just how denim was Employed in apparel. This marked the beginning of denim's journey from a practical workwear cloth to your vogue staple. All through the 20th century, denim became synonymous with rebellion and youth society, with legendary figures including James Dean and Marilyn Monroe popularizing denim jeans as a image of independence and individuality. Right now, denim is really a ubiquitous part of vogue, with many variations and models that cater to a wide array of tastes and Tastes.

Various Shades of Denim
One of the more interesting areas of denim is its flexibility when it comes to color and wash. From common indigo to light-weight clean and black denim, you will find many shades and versions from which to choose. Indigo denim, with its deep blue hue, is Probably the most legendary and timeless of all denim shades. It really is functional and will be dressed up or down, rendering it a favorite option for both casual and formal wear. Light wash denim, However, has a more relaxed and laid-back vibe, perfect for developing a classic-encouraged glimpse. Black denim is modern and complex, presenting a contemporary twist about the vintage fabric. It can be dressed up for an evening out or paired with everyday items for a more calm appear. Denim Care Recommendations
Good care is essential for preserving the quality and longevity of your respective denim parts. To maintain the colour and condition of your jeans, it's important to wash them inside out in cold water using a gentle detergent. Keep away from working with severe chemical compounds or bleach, since they could cause fading and harm to the fabric. When drying your denim, air-drying is greatest to avoid shrinkage and sustain the integrity in the fibers. If you should iron your denim, achieve this inside out on the very low warmth environment in order to avoid harmful the fabric. By next these very simple treatment guidelines, it is possible to be certain that your denim pieces remain in major affliction For a long time to come.
